NCT00918541

Brief Summary

20 patients will be recruited. The aim of the study is to determine the natural progression of atherosclerotic disease.

Eligibility Criteria

Sexall
Healthy VolunteersNo
Age GroupsChild (0-17), Adult (18-64), Older Adult (65+)
Sampling MethodNon-Probability Sample
Study Population

Patients of the districthospital Bellinzona

You may qualify if:

  • stable carotid artery disease not requiring revascularization
  • asymptomatic carotid artery stenosis \< 80% or symptomatic patients with stenosis \< 60 %
  • prophylactic therapy with aspirin (\> 100mg/day, statin, blood pressure therapy if indicated (goal \< 130/80 mmHg))
  • informed consent

You may not qualify if:

  • non atherosclerotic occlusive disease (Bürgers disease)
  • uncontrolled BP (DBP \> 110 mmHg and/or SBP \> 200 mmHg)
  • hemorrhagic disease or platelet count \< 100'000 mm\^3
  • Known active liver disease (elevations of GPT GOT or increased ammonia)
  • impaired renal function (crea \> 180 mmol/l)
  • pregnancy
  • severe claustrophobic reactions
  • short - term life - threatening pathology
  • physically unable to participate in the study
  • compliance not guaranteed
